The 'Add to Cart' box on an Amazon listing. When multiple sellers offer the same product, the Buy Box winner takes the sale by default, so holding it is the difference between owning your listing and watching someone else monetise it. Winning is driven by price, fulfilment method and seller performance, and FBA carries a strong structural advantage: in most categories the Prime badge beats a lower price from a non-Prime seller, because customers filter by Prime. The Buy Box is also where knockoff pain lands - a hijacker undercutting you takes sales on the page you built, which is why Brand Registry and counterfeit reporting matter.
Benchmark. The qualitative test: you hold the Buy Box on your own branded listings. If you are losing it, check fulfilment method first - FBA almost always wins for discoverability and the Buy Box - then find out who the competing seller actually is.
